Nurturing Sober Accountability Partnerships

Sustaining sobriety is bolstered by establishing sober accountability partnerships, a focus area at Top Sober House. These partnerships are designed to pair residents with accountability partners who bolster their recovery efforts. Partners commit to regularly checking in, attending meetings together, and setting shared goals, reinforcing a sense of responsibility and commitment. These partnerships create a robust framework for residents to hold one another accountable in a safe and non-judgmental environment. By relying on each other, individuals strengthen their resolve against relapse, fostering an environment where sobriety is not only maintained but celebrated. The continuous support and encouragement from accountability partners play a significant role in ensuring enduring recovery success.
